What Happens in a Delayed Metal Reaction

A metal reaction from an implant usually isn’t the fast, hives-and-swelling kind of allergy you might picture.

It builds slowly as your immune cells learn to recognize metal ions released from the implant surface, and the type of alloy in that implant changes which metals your body is actually exposed to.

Type IV Hypersensitivity and T-Cell Memory

Reactions to implanted metal are almost always type IV hypersensitivity, also called delayed-type hypersensitivity. Instead of antibodies, your T cells drive the immune response.

Here’s the basic sequence:

  1. Metal ions leak from the implant and bind to proteins in your tissue.
  2. Your immune system treats that metal-protein pair as something foreign.
  3. T cells multiply and release chemical signals like IL-1, IL-6, and interferon-gamma.
  4. Inflammation builds around the implant over weeks or months.

The important part for testing is memory. Once your T cells have reacted, some of them stay in your blood ready to respond again.

That’s why lab tests look at lymphocyte reactivity in a blood sample rather than just a skin patch. Skin tests can miss reactions happening in deeper tissue around the implant.

Titanium Ions, Wear, and Corrosion

Titanium doesn’t sit in your body untouched. Two processes free up metal ions: slow corrosion of the surface, and wear from movement and friction between parts.

Those titanium ions bind to your proteins, which is the first step in a sensitivity reaction. Tiny wear particles also get swallowed up by immune cells called macrophages.

Titanium particles and ions may contribute to inflammatory reactions in surrounding tissues, although implant complications can have many other biological and mechanical causes.

Symptoms tend to be quiet at first: aching, stiffness, swelling, or a rash that doesn’t have another clear cause.

Titanium Alloys and Other Potential Allergens

“Titanium implant” rarely means pure titanium. Most hardware is a titanium alloy blended with other metals, and those additions matter a lot.

Common alloy componentWhy it matters
Aluminum, vanadiumComponents of Ti-6Al-4V, a titanium alloy used in some dental implant systems
NickelA common metal allergen that may be relevant when evaluating a patient’s history of metal sensitivity
Cobalt, chromiumMetals used in some dental alloys and restorations that can trigger hypersensitivity in sensitized patients

Nickel, cobalt, and chromium are more commonly associated with metal hypersensitivity than titanium.

That is why a history of reactions to these metals can still matter when you are being evaluated for dental implant treatment.

Patch testing may include nickel sulfate, cobalt chloride, and potassium dichromate for chromium.

If you have a known or suspected metal allergy, ask your dental team which materials are present in the implant system and restoration so your allergist can determine which metals are relevant to test.

Patch Testing for Suspected Metal Allergy

If you tell your surgeon you react to jewelry or belt buckles, you will probably be sent for a skin patch test.

It is the standard way doctors check for delayed metal reactions, and it works well for some metals and poorly for others.

How Patch Testing Is Performed

A dermatologist or allergist tapes small chambers to your upper back. Each chamber holds a tiny amount of a suspected allergen mixed in petrolatum.

Most clinics start with a baseline panel that includes nickel sulfate, cobalt chloride, and potassium dichromate. Extra metals, such as titanium salts, vanadium, or palladium, can be added when an implant is planned.

The patches stay on for 48 hours. You keep your back dry during that time, then return so the patches can be removed and read.

Your skin is checked again at 72 or 96 hours, and sometimes as late as day 7, because delayed-type hypersensitivity reactions often show up slowly.

What a Positive Skin Result Can and Cannot Tell You

A positive spot is red, slightly raised, and often itchy or bumpy. That pattern points to allergic contact dermatitis from that specific metal.

The reading scale matters. Doctors separate true allergic responses from irritant reactions, which look sharp-edged, appear fast, and fade quickly once the patch comes off.

Here is the honest limit: a positive result tells you your skin is sensitized. It does not predict that a screw or plate placed near bone will fail.

Testing also cuts both ways. One study of dental implant patients found no clear link between reported metal allergy history and titanium sensitization, so your history alone will not settle the question.

Limits of Patch Tests for Titanium

Titanium is the weak spot. The salts used in patch chambers do not penetrate skin well, and results are frequently negative even in people who later have trouble.

Reactions can happen in deep tissue around the implant while your skin stays quiet.

One review of foot and ankle cases noted that patch testing often misses these deep tissue reactions, while blood-based lymphocyte testing picked up more cases.

Because of this gap, routine testing is not recommended for people with no history of metal reactions or past implant problems.

If you do have a clear history, ask about pairing patch testing with a lymphocyte-based test rather than relying on skin alone.

Making a Preoperative Plan With Your Care Team

Good planning starts with three simple things: knowing exactly what metals are in your implant, discussing backup materials if needed, and understanding what testing can and cannot promise.

Reviewing the Exact Implant Materials

Ask your dental implant team for the brand and material composition of the implant system being considered. This information can help your allergist determine which metals, if any, are relevant to evaluate.

A dental implant system may involve more than the implant fixture itself.

The abutment and final restoration can contain different materials, so reviewing the complete treatment plan is more useful than focusing only on the word “titanium.”

MaterialWhy it may be relevant
TitaniumCommonly used for dental implant fixtures and components
Aluminum, vanadiumComponents of Ti-6Al-4V used in some titanium dental implant systems
Cobalt, chromiumMay be present in certain dental alloys and restorations

Considering Alternative Materials When Appropriate

If your history and test results raise concerns about metal hypersensitivity, your dental implant team can discuss whether another implant material is appropriate.

Zirconia dental implants provide a metal-free alternative to titanium in selected cases.

However, the right material depends on factors such as implant location, available bone, bite forces, and the restoration you need.

An alternative material is not automatically the better choice simply because you are concerned about titanium sensitivity.

Keeping Expectations Realistic About Implant Outcomes

Titanium reactions are uncommon. A study reported allergy to titanium ions sits around 0.6% to 1.0% of people, and the metal is not tested often, so that number may be low.

No test is perfect. Patch testing can miss deep tissue reactions, and readings taken on day seven help catch delayed responses that a two-day check would miss.

Testing makes the most sense if you have a history of metal hypersensitivity, asthma, or autoimmune disease, or if a prior implant failed without a clear reason.

A negative result does not fully rule out a reaction, and a positive result does not guarantee implant failure. Treat testing as one piece of information that guides your plan, not a final verdict.

Symptoms After Surgery and Next Diagnostic Steps

Pain, swelling, or a rash weeks or months after your implant goes in doesn’t automatically mean you have a metal allergy.

The harder job is ruling out the more common causes first, then deciding whether allergy testing and a specialist opinion will actually change your treatment plan.

Separating Allergy From Infection, Loosening, and Other Causes

Metal hypersensitivity and infection can look almost identical from the outside. Both can cause swelling, warmth, ongoing pain, and poor healing at the surgical site.

Your surgeon usually works through the more likely explanations first:

Possible causeCommon clues
Peri-implant infection or inflammationRedness, swelling, bleeding, drainage, tenderness, or bone loss around the implant
Implant or restoration problemMovement, discomfort when chewing, a changed bite, or a loose implant component
Metal hypersensitivityPersistent unexplained tissue irritation or inflammation after more common causes have been investigated

Allergy becomes a serious possibility when cultures come back clean, imaging looks fine, and the skin over your titanium implant stays irritated.

Reported cases of titanium hypersensitivity in patients with implants share that pattern: positive allergy testing plus no better explanation.

When Specialist Evaluation May Help

If your symptoms don’t fit an infection or a mechanical problem, ask for a referral. An allergist or dermatologist can run patch testing, and some clinics order blood-based lymphocyte testing.

Patch testing checks your skin’s reaction, but it can miss deep tissue responses. That’s one reason the MELISA lymphocyte test is used after surgery to look for a titanium-specific immune response in the blood.

A systematic review comparing patch testing and MELISA found MELISA more accurate for titanium, and noted that ceramic or niobium implants may suit patients with known metal allergies.

Why Testing Is Only One Part of the Decision

Your surgeon weighs the test result against your symptoms, your imaging, how well the bone has healed, and the risk of a second operation.

Sometimes the answer is topical steroids and watchful waiting.

Other times, when symptoms are severe and every other cause has been excluded, removing or replacing the hardware is what finally resolves the reaction and prevents ongoing implant failure.

Frequently Asked Questions

Titanium allergy is uncommon, affecting an estimated 0.6% to 1.0% of people, but it can cause ongoing swelling, pain, and even implant failure when it does happen.

How can I find out if I’m allergic to titanium before surgery?

Start by telling your surgeon about any past reactions to metal, including jewelry, braces, or older hardware. That history matters more than most people realize.

From there, you can ask about blood-based lymphocyte testing.

Pre-surgery metal sensitivity testing may be discussed if you have a history of skin reactions to metals or a previous dental implant that developed unexplained complications.

One helpful step: ask for the exact metal makeup of the implant your surgeon plans to use. Most “titanium” implants are alloys that also contain aluminum, vanadium, or nickel, so you may want testing for those metals too.

What symptoms might suggest a titanium hypersensitivity reaction?

Reactions usually show up slowly, not right away. Common signs include:

  • Skin rash, hives, or eczema near the implant site
  • Swelling and warmth that does not go away
  • Pain that gets worse instead of better over weeks
  • Fluid buildup or drainage with no infection found
  • Loose hardware or poor bone healing around the implant

Some people also report tiredness or a general unwell feeling. Because these signs overlap with infection and mechanical problems, your care team will want to rule out other causes first.

Reviews of titanium reactions and implant intolerance explain how doctors tell an allergy apart from infection or simple irritation.

Which tests are used to check for titanium allergy, and how reliable are they?

Two main options exist: skin patch testing and blood lymphocyte testing, such as MELISA or the lymphocyte transformation test.

Titanium allergy is a type IV, or delayed, reaction. Your T cells respond to titanium ions released from the implant, which means the response takes days rather than minutes.

Allergy specialists agree there is credible evidence supporting delayed hypersensitivity testing for metals as a way to spot contact allergy.

Still, no test is perfect, so results should always be read alongside your symptoms and imaging.

Is patch testing effective for detecting a possible titanium allergy?

Patch testing works reasonably well for metals like nickel, but it has real limits with titanium.

Titanium salts used on patches often do not absorb well through the skin, so a negative result can be misleading.

Research on titanium implants and type IV hypersensitivity found that patch testing frequently misses reactions happening in deeper tissue around an implant.

So a clear patch test does not fully rule out sensitivity. It can still be useful for checking the other metals in an alloy.

How accurate is the MELISA test for titanium sensitivity?

MELISA is a blood test that measures how your white blood cells respond when exposed to specific metals in the lab.

Studies comparing methods report it detects titanium reactions more accurately than patch testing, especially deep tissue responses.

You can arrange MELISA testing for titanium hypersensitivity through a partner clinic or by sending a blood sample to a lab.

Keep expectations realistic. A positive result shows sensitization, not a guarantee that your implant will fail, so your doctor will weigh it with everything else.

What should I do if I’ve reacted to titanium or other metals before?

Write down what happened and when. Note the item, how long before symptoms started, and what the reaction looked like. Photos help a lot.

Bring that record to your pre-surgery visit and ask directly about testing. Reported allergy rates may be underreported because titanium is rarely tested, so speaking up matters.

If testing raises concerns about titanium sensitivity, ask your dental implant team whether a metal-free option such as zirconia may be appropriate for your case.
